The implementation of community service with the title The Role of Teenagers in Reducing Plastic Waste in Schools is an invitation to live a clean culture from an early age and cleanliness is a shared responsibility that must always be instilled from an early age. Instilling cleanliness at an early age will shape the culture and character of adolescents in life at school or in society and is a reflection of a form of concern for a clean environment so as to provide awareness in a clean environment. The role of adolescents in creating a clean environment, namely: 1) Throwing trash in the place provided by the school, 2) inviting other school friends to maintain the cleanliness of the school, 3) Providing education about the importance of clean living in the school environment, 4) the principles of Reduce (Reducing waste) Reuse (Reusing) and Recycle (Recycling) and explaining to students about separating waste according to its type. A clean school culture is also the responsibility of all parties in the school and this reflects a shared awareness that must always be considered and always educated to all students so that a clean environment becomes an absolute must for all parties.
